問題タブ [dollar-sign]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
21518 参照

python - Pythonで$記号で始まる文字列内のすべての単語を検索します

$記号で始まる文字列内のすべての単語を抽出するにはどうすればよいですか?たとえば、文字列で

$string単語とを抽出したい$example

この正規表現を試してみまし\b[$]\S*たが、ドルではなく通常の文字を使用した場合にのみ正常に機能します。

0 投票する
6 に答える
13582 参照

javascript - $ Chrome の変数 (ドル記号)?

jQuery(または$記号をショートカットとして使用する他のライブラリ)のないページでGoogle Chromeの開発者ツールを使用していました。$コンソールで(入力してEnterキーを押すだけで)調べたところ、次のようになりました。

そのため、chrome には で参照できるネイティブ関数がいくつかあります$window['$']クロムだけがこれを持っているようで、経由でも経由でもアクセスできませdocument['$']this['$']

この機能が何であるかを見つけることができませんでした。それが何をするか知っていますか、これに関する背景情報を持っていますか? 前もって感謝します!

0 投票する
1 に答える
881 参照

antlr - ANTLRのシンボルへの参照にドル記号$を置くのはいつですか?

私は T.Parr による ANTLR に関する本を 2 冊持っていますが、ドル記号がいたるところにシンボルへの言及が見られます。それは私にとってもうまくいきました:

またはもっと複雑なもの:

しかし、この行は私にばかげたエラーを与えます:

エラーは言うmissing attribute access on rule scope: ex。あなたは修正が何であるか知っていますか?「ex」のドル記号を削除します。それでおしまい。

好奇心から、前述のルール (上記) を確認し、ドル記号を削除しました。以前と同じように機能します (つまり、エラーは発生しません)。

質問: では、このドル記号の話は何ですか? 使わなくていいの?それとも、エラーになるまで使用する必要がありますか?

この規則がANTLRの標準としてほとんど使用されているのを見なければ、私はこの質問をしません。

0 投票する
2 に答える
50722 参照

postgresql - PL/pgSQLで使用される「$$」は何ですか

PL/pgSQL はまったく新しいので、この関数の二重のドル記号の意味は何ですか:

RETURNS boolean AS $$inは$$プレースホルダーだと思います。

最後の行は少し謎です:$$ LANGUAGE plpgsql STRICT IMMUTABLE;

ところで、最後の行はどういう意味ですか?

0 投票する
3 に答える
53312 参照

r - 変数の前のドル記号

既存のデータ フレーム「my_data」から新しいデータ フレーム「new_data」を作成するサンプル コードがあります。

問題は、my_data$cond(cond は変数であり、列名ではない) が受け入れられないことです。

ドル記号の後に変数値を使用して、データ フレームの列を呼び出すにはどうすればよいですか?

0 投票する
2 に答える
4950 参照

java - JavareplaceAll/文字列をドル記号のインスタンスに置き換えます

理解できない。私は、見つけたすべてのスタックオーバーフローを含め、インターネットで見つけた置換を行うためのすべての方法を使用しました。私も\u0024を試しました!どうしたの?

0 投票する
1 に答える
243 参照

php - 正規表現-ドル記号は、別の文字が続く場合にのみ一致します

正規表現とドル記号についてはたくさんのスレッドがあることを私は知っています。しかし、私が読んだものはまったく役に立ちませんでした。\b(foo bar\$)s?\bと一致するはずのこの正規表現がfoo bar$ありfoo bar$sます。問題は、正規表現はにのみ一致するということですfoo bar$s

それはのため\b(foo bar)s?\bに働きfoo barfoo bars

ドルは名前の一部なので、削除できません。

何か案は?

0 投票する
3 に答える
187 参照

javascript - $ sign in "jQuery(function($){...}"はjQueryをどのように参照しますか?

以下では、$記号はjQueryを参照していると表示されています。方法を理解するのに助けが必要ですか?

0 投票する
1 に答える
178 参照

javascript - Gmail、リーダー、検索などの Google サイトの JavaScript で使用される「$$」変数/オブジェクトは何ですか?

重複の可能性:
Chrome /Ffirefox のダブルドル記号セレクター クエリ関数のソースは何ですか?

Search、Gmail、Reader などの多くの主要な Google サイト (Web アプリケーション) では、$オブジェクトだけでなくオブジェクトも定義されていることに気付きました$$

前者が何であるかはわかりませんが、後者には少なくともjQueryに似たセレクター機能があります。

$$ただし、jQuery自体は完全ではありません。のようなことはできますが、できませ$$('main')$$('main').text()

この$$物体が何かわかる人いますか?jQueryの縮小版ですか?Sizzleセレクターエンジンですか?jQueryに少し似ている他のフレームワークですか?

それはどこかに文書化されていますか?

おまけの質問:

  • 他のjQuery機能を備えたGoogleサイトに他のオブジェクトがありますか?
  • $彼らが使用するオブジェクトは何ですか?

背景: Google サイトの Google Chrome ユーザー スクリプト (Greasemonkey など) で jQuery を動作させるには、スクリプト タグを使用してサイトに jQuery を挿入するか、ページにユーザー スクリプト コードを挿入してフレームワークやライブラリを使用するかに関係なく、問題が発生しました。すでに含まれている可能性があります。

0 投票する
3 に答える
17115 参照

c++ - c++: double をドル記号で通貨にフォーマットするにはどうすればよいですか?

double を受け取り、それを 1000 区切りの文字列として返す関数があります。ここで確認できます: c++: 数値をコンマでフォーマットしますか?

今、ドル記号で通貨としてフォーマットできるようにしたいと考えています。具体的には、20500 の倍数が与えられた場合、「$20,500」などの文字列を取得したいと考えています。

「$-5,000」ではなく「-$5,000」が必要なため、負の数の場合は先頭にドル記号を付けても機能しません。